Author: curtisr7
Date: Tue Nov  6 17:44:51 2012
New Revision: 1406242

URL: http://svn.apache.org/viewvc?rev=1406242&view=rev
Log:
OPENJPA-2293: Don't check for listeners if exclude-default-listener is 
configured. Merged from trunk.

Modified:
    
openjpa/branches/2.2.1.x/openjpa-kernel/src/main/java/org/apache/openjpa/kernel/StateManagerImpl.java

Modified: 
openjpa/branches/2.2.1.x/openjpa-kernel/src/main/java/org/apache/openjpa/kernel/StateManagerImpl.java
URL: 
http://svn.apache.org/viewvc/openjpa/branches/2.2.1.x/openjpa-kernel/src/main/java/org/apache/openjpa/kernel/StateManagerImpl.java?rev=1406242&r1=1406241&r2=1406242&view=diff
==============================================================================
--- 
openjpa/branches/2.2.1.x/openjpa-kernel/src/main/java/org/apache/openjpa/kernel/StateManagerImpl.java
 (original)
+++ 
openjpa/branches/2.2.1.x/openjpa-kernel/src/main/java/org/apache/openjpa/kernel/StateManagerImpl.java
 Tue Nov  6 17:44:51 2012
@@ -3277,7 +3277,7 @@ public class StateManagerImpl
 
         // no listeners?
         LifecycleEventManager mgr = _broker.getLifecycleEventManager();
-        if (mgr == null || !mgr.hasLoadListeners(getManagedInstance(), _meta))
+        if (mgr == null || !mgr.isActive(_meta) || 
!mgr.hasLoadListeners(getManagedInstance(), _meta))
             return;
 
         if (fetch == null)


Reply via email to